Writing on the Screen
In any program that accepts writing, such as the Notes program, you can use
your stylus to write directly on the screen. Write the way you do on paper. You
can edit and format what you have written and convert the information to text
later.
To write on the screen, tap Draw to switch to drawing mode. A check ()
appears before the command.
NOTE: Not all programs support the drawing mode.
Drawing on the Screen
You can draw on the screen in the same way that you write on the screen.
1. Tap Draw to enable drawing mode. A check () appears before the
command.
2. To create a drawing, cross three ruled lines on your first stroke. A drawing
box appears.
3. Subsequent strokes in or touching the drawing box become part of the
drawing. Drawings that do not cross three ruled lines will be treated as
writing.
